Legal Framework and Prescription Requirements in Italy
Italy has really particular laws concerning the prescription of narcotic and psychotropic compounds. Unlike over-the-counter medications or basic prescription drugs, getting Oxycodone requires stringent adherence to nationwide health procedures.
The Special Prescription Pad (La Ricetta Ministeriale a Ricalco)
In the past, Italy used a specialized, counterfoil-type prescription pad (referred to as the ricetta ministeriale a ricalco) for all narcotic drugs. While current legislative updates have actually modernized some aspects of this procedure-- enabling doctors to utilize electronic prescriptions for specific illegal drugs-- opioids like oxycodone still require rigorous paperwork.

Summary of Medication Classification in Italy
To better comprehend how pharmaceutical items are categorized, the following table outlines the classification system used by the Italian Medicines Agency (AIFA):
Classification CategoryDescriptionAccess RequirementsSOP (Senza Obbligo di Prescrizione)Over-the-counter medications showed to the general public.Direct purchase in drug stores.OTC (Over The Counter)Self-medication drugs advertised to the general public.Direct purchase in pharmacies.RR (Ricetta Ripetibile)Requirement prescription drugs that can be filled up.Legitimate doctor prescription (valid approximately 6 months, max 10 times).RNRL (Ricetta Non Ripetibile Limitativa)Limiting non-refillable prescription for specific professionals.Professional prescription, legitimate for 30 days.Stupefacenti (Narcotics/ Oxycodone)Highly regulated substances with high dependence capacity.Special secure prescription procedures; stringent identity verification.How to Obtain Oxycodone Legally

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)1. Can I purchase oxycodone online in Italy?
No. It is strictly illegal to acquire narcotic medications like oxycodone through online pharmacies, unverified websites, or classified ads in Italy. Online sales of prescription-only controlled substances are banned, and engaging in such purchases can cause extreme legal consequences, including criminal prosecution.
2. Can I utilize a foreign prescription to purchase oxycodone in Italy?
Generally, basic paper prescriptions provided by doctors outside of Italy are not accepted for illegal drugs like opioids. Travelers requiring a refill should speak with an Italian doctor to get a valid regional prescription.
3. Is oxycodone covered by the Italian National Health Service (SSN)?
Yes, for particular signs (such as serious persistent pain associated to oncological diseases), oxycodone might be totally or partially compensated by the SSN, supplied it is prescribed according to national restorative standards. Non-oncological discomfort management might undergo different regional copayment guidelines (ticket).
